Lost Your Passport in Thailand? Here’s How to Handle It

  Losing your passport while traveling can be stressful, but don’t worry. Here’s a quick guide on what to do if it happens in Thailand. Step 1: Gather These Documents First, make sure you have these items ready: Application Form  – Get this from the Immigration Office. New Passport and a Copy  – Visit your embassy to get a new one, and make a copy of the main page. Police Report  – Report your lost passport at the local police station and get a report. Certificate from Your Embassy  – Your embassy will give you a certificate with your new passport details. Step 2: Visit Immigration If You’re in Bangkok : Head to the Lost Passport Section at the Immigration Office. Fill out a form with your details, like your name, passport number, and when you arrived in Thailand. Check the info on your new passport. Joint Ventures in Thailand: Legal Framework and Considerations

Thailand is an attractive destination for foreign investors, thanks to its strategic location, growing economy, and favorable government policies. One of the most effective ways for foreign companies to enter the Thai market is through joint ventures. This article explores the legal framework and key considerations for establishing joint ventures in Thailand, offering insights for businesses looking to leverage this business model. Understanding Joint Ventures in Thailand A joint venture (JV) is a business arrangement where two or more parties come together to undertake a specific project or business activity. In Thailand, JVs can take various forms, such as partnerships or limited companies. The choice of structure depends on the nature of the business, the level of foreign ownership, and the specific goals of the parties involved.
